Resilient Connectivity Network Meeting

Strong communities start with strong connections—and those connections can make all the difference when storms, heatwaves, or emergencies strike. Join us for an action-packed workshop where you'll learn how to build a Community Connections Plan that strengthens relationships in your neighborhood every day while creating an emergency preparedness network for when disruptions happen.

In this hands-on workshop, you'll:

  • Design a Neighbor Connector system tailored to your community—whether you're a street-based neighborhood, apartment building, faith community, or online group

  • Identify your first Neighbor Connectors using proven frameworks

  • Identify vulnerable neighbors who may need extra support during emergencies or disruptions

  • Create an action plan for social events like block parties and seasonal gatherings that build everyday connections

  • Walk away with concrete next steps and ready-to-use tools to activate relationship building in your POD

You'll hear from:

  • 🏘️ San Antonio neighborhood PODs sharing real stories of resilience—from front-yard fiestas to wellness checks and support clusters

  • 🚨 Office of Emergency Management on emergency preparedness systems

  • 📻 ARES/Ham Radio network representatives on communications that work even when the power goes out
